Hi Folks,

I just upgraded a dev site from 1.11.7 -> 1.11.9 and after this works fine i tried to upgrade all modules.

After upgrading FeUsers from Version 1.21.10 -> 1.22 i got this message in frontend:
Fatal error: Class 'CGExtensions' not found in /homepages/xxxxsitefolderxxx/modules/FrontEndUsers/FrontEndUsers.module.php on line 41
So i copied a Folder with 1.21.10 to this site modules folder and it works now again. How to get the new FeUser version working?
